を使用RFモジュールを司会

A

anandpv2009

Guest
私は..... RFモジュールを使用して2つのPICのMCSを通信午前しようとする
私は私を助けてピンされたRXの接続モジュールdireclyにTX写真1はmcのとすることができます適切ボー作品の500bps.But起動しなけれそれは...

送受信三菱商事はしかし、受信信号を自分のプロジェクトのメインではない関係ですが、correctly.Its緊急のため...

 
データをしないメーカーが指定すると、これらのUARTの送信ができるモジュールは何ですか?ほとんどのシンプルなモジュールではありません。

 
私はvegakitsから買われた。

データをする場合のUART送信することができないそれは何ですか?すればよいです..何を
年頃か/それはCCSのコードです接続が可能¥に直接PICの他のmcはなくICs.Because投稿私plsは必要な高可能¥であればそれがある場合のボーレート...感謝

 
ベガキットには、キット、趣味、ロボットは、単にディーラーのRF mudules。しないメーカーです。彼が販売しているすべてのモジュールは、中国からです。これらのモジュールは、転送データ速度の低いことができますが使用されるリモート制御または。私は料金疑いについてボー高いモジュール働いている人"构造FVMは"書いている。

 
HT12D/HT12Eすることができますmodule.Without uはに写真を直接説明する方法を接続...

 
私が直接信号とUARTは)ほとんどAsk(双方のモジュールを持って聞いて異なる意見について可能¥性のRFの単純な動作。の理解では私、彼らは、UARTが関与困難を処理する大規模なデューティサイクルの範囲(10 - )%90ビットストリーム。

個人的に、私は同期とは、常に実装マンチェスタープリアンブルとエンコーディング。上の場合は場合は、追跡することができますを取るビットレートや必要な正確な速度トランスミッタは、簡単にマンチェスターは非常にはエンコードでテキサス州に依存送受信でデコード努力。どちらがPICとすることができますソ¥フトウェアは行わで、私は思います。

 
個人的に、私は同期とは、常に実装マンチェスタープリアンブルとエンコーディング。
上の場合は場合は、追跡することができますを取るビットレートや必要な正確な速度トランスミッタは、簡単にマンチェスターは非常にはエンコードでテキサス州に依存送受信でデコード努力。
どちらがPICとすることができますソ¥フトウェアは行わで、私は]と思う。[/引用
あなたとの間の通信を持って言及参考になることでしょうマンチェスターは、コーディングに両面フルやっレシーバです私は場合コーディングする必要があるとアドバイスをどのようにしてください2 AT8051 0r 8031?

してくださいすることができます助言すべてを。

 
電子メールは私のコード私はあなたを助ける

 
Ganesh_kolheは書き込み:

電子メールは私のコード私はあなたを助ける
 
こんにちは、....ガネーシュ

私が入ったはずです。私はモジュールのRF符号化方法のために出管理する機能¥。私はそれを必要とするincaseの誰かはよ投稿私の.....コードを

 
thand - sは書き込み:

こんにちは、....ガネーシュ私が入ったはずです。私は、RFモジュールをコーディングするための方法を考え出すことができた。私は.....ただ、誰かがそれを必要とincaseの自分のコードを作成します
 
[OK]をIsaacJn、私は米国を助ける

まず、UARTをサポートする必要がありますことを確認モジュールは、ウルが。

手順に従って、これらの。

1。を減らす)ボー(最小
2。送信番号のように最初の0x55またはアスキー。これは、エラーを削減するには役立ちます。
3。使用して、マンチェスターコーディング。
4。ウル回路をテストFRMはTXの中またはRxの回路から2〜3の距離の足配置する必要がUは
5。を使用し反転モード動作
6。送信データを2回受信するよう確認します。

.....幸運
の最後の編集時に2010年1月16日午前8時27分;編集回数:1 anandpv2009合計

 
anandpv2009は、ヘルプをご利用の感謝を。

私は注意して、アプリケーションはこのしてされて勉強:
http://www.quickbuilder.co.uk/qb/articles/Manchester_encoding_using_RS232.pdf

問題は、コードが指定されたCCSをすることができます使用してコンパイルするだけ。私は前にCCSを使ったことがない。私はコンパイラC18の午前使用します。はそれが可能¥コード場合を見て私はできますか?

について

 
IsaacJnは書き込み:

anandpv2009は、あなたの助けてくれてありがとう。私は、このアプリケーションノートを検討している:

http://www.quickbuilder.co.uk/qb/articles/Manchester_encoding_using_RS232.pdf問題は、コードが指定された唯一のCCSを使用してコンパイルすることができます。
私は前にCCSを使ったことがない。
私はC18のコンパイラを使用しています。
はそれが可能¥私はあなたのコードを見ることができますか?について
 
anandpv2009、

私は)トランスミッタを使用してTX2 433 160(午前radiometrix Rx2の433 160(receciverから)。私はシートのデータが読んで、それはdoesn'tのUARTについては何も言う。コードでは私の私は、UARTをサポートしていないですそれを使用してusart libraries.Soを多分ことを仮定私は?

上記のコード来るCCSは、私がbit_clearはいけない理解何bit_testは、bit_setと?

私の送信コードは、このようになります:

)中(1


/ /プリアンブル
BusyUSART中(());
WriteUSART(0x55);
BusyUSART中(());
WriteUSART(0x55);

/ /バイトを送信UARTの同期
BusyUSART中(());
WriteUSART(0xFF)の;

/ /コードを送信開始
BusyUSART中(());
WriteUSART(0x00)を;
BusyUSART中(());
WriteUSART(0xFEの);/ /私はここの問題は、私はいけないデータを知るエンコードする方法

BusyUSART中(());
WriteUSART(0x25);
BusyUSART中(());
WriteUSART(0x25);

/ 0x25の送信を示す/
Delay10TCYx(50); / / *
(もしTXREG == 0x25)
LATAbits.LATA1 = 1;

LATAbits.LATA1 = 0;

 
IsaacJnは書き込み:

anandpv2009、CCSは上記のコードに来て、私はbit_testは、bit_setとbit_clearを行う理解しない?

 

Welcome to EDABoard.com

Sponsor

Back
Top